This means that it's possible that they are supposed to be blacklisted by udev properties, but weren't. Also, in order to avoid doing potentially stalling IO, update_pathvec_from_dm() doesn't get all the path information in pathinfo(). These paths end up in the unexpected state of INIT_MISSING_UDEV or INIT_NEW, but with their mpp and wwid set. If udev has already initialized the path, but multipathed wasn't monitoring it, the blacklist checks and wwid determination in update_pathvec_from_dm() will work correctly, so paths added by it are safe, but not completely initialized. The most likely reason why this would happen is if the path was manually removed from multipathd monitoring with "multipathd del path". The most common time when uninitialized paths would in be part of multipath devices is during boot, after the pivot root, but before the udev coldplug happens. These paths are not necessarily safe. It's possible that /etc/multipath.conf in the initramfs and regular filesystem differ, and they should now be either blacklisted by udev_property, or have a different wwid. However an "add" event should appear for them shortly. Multipath now has a new state to deal with these devices, INIT_PARTIAL. Devices in this state are treated mostly like INIT_OK devices, but when "multipathd add path" is called or an add/change uevent happens on these devices, multipathd will finish initializing them, and remove them if necessary.
